    Hyderabad: On Tuesday, government officials took down illegal buildings in Kokapet’s survey number 100, under tight security. These buildings were being built on government land without proper approval.

    Residents had filed several complaints about the issue. In response, the Gandipet Revenue Department arrived at the location early in the morning. With the help of machines and a large police presence, they started the demolition. The entire area was blocked off to maintain order and ensure safety during the operation.

    - Advertisement -

    Officials said that the illegal construction included commercial buildings on land that had been taken over without permission. The demolition was carried out under official orders to reclaim the land and stop any further illegal building activity.
